Antoine Riard
|
4ba4d19dc8
|
inchallah
|
2017-03-29 14:33:23 +02:00 |
|
Antoine Riard
|
e87dbff14c
|
andor seems good
|
2017-03-29 13:43:07 +02:00 |
|
Antoine Riard
|
7d08adfb4e
|
rebuilding cd, en cours
|
2017-03-25 17:05:47 +01:00 |
|
Antoine Riard
|
5d07da9fb3
|
close #189 close #190
|
2017-03-24 19:44:04 +01:00 |
|
Antoine Riard
|
6ae49e3637
|
close #173
|
2017-03-24 17:10:14 +01:00 |
|
Antoine Riard
|
d763c7304f
|
error for + case fix close #174
|
2017-03-24 15:19:01 +01:00 |
|
Antoine Riard
|
b95476a0be
|
error for + case fix close #174
|
2017-03-24 15:18:17 +01:00 |
|
Antoine Riard
|
137aa1d976
|
protecting against malloc failure in parser
|
2017-03-18 19:20:00 +01:00 |
|
Antoine Riard
|
3a58fcd715
|
no more from pop_stack and ast_free
|
2017-03-18 17:38:26 +01:00 |
|
Antoine Riard
|
d47557fdd1
|
brackets good
|
2017-03-18 15:53:19 +01:00 |
|
Antoine Riard
|
7f236af741
|
correction syntax + mise a la norme parser
|
2017-03-17 18:43:21 +01:00 |
|
Antoine Riard
|
64d5500c8d
|
main good
|
2017-03-16 22:30:02 +01:00 |
|
Jack Halford
|
bed9f1d6c2
|
mean cleanup
|
2017-03-16 15:04:21 +01:00 |
|
Antoine Riard
|
a68ad0af01
|
func ok
|
2017-03-15 20:08:04 +01:00 |
|
Antoine Riard
|
95186a124f
|
func ok:
|
2017-03-15 19:57:08 +01:00 |
|
Jack Halford
|
dec15b7ae2
|
close p.to_close before redirections
|
2017-03-15 17:57:31 +01:00 |
|
Antoine Riard
|
5c2bb40bf6
|
assignement word as word if in second position
|
2017-03-13 17:52:36 +01:00 |
|
Antoine Riard
|
bc97d45f44
|
correctif io number
|
2017-03-11 16:47:33 +01:00 |
|
Antoine Riard
|
729cf55cd3
|
grosse mise a la norme des func parser
|
2017-03-11 16:24:18 +01:00 |
|
Antoine Riard
|
58c6491d23
|
parsing redir + struct control doing
|
2017-03-10 19:47:04 +01:00 |
|
Antoine Riard
|
488d7bf800
|
grammar moar beton
|
2017-03-10 19:04:14 +01:00 |
|
Antoine Riard
|
a2628f4302
|
new parsing des if
|
2017-03-10 18:09:13 +01:00 |
|
Antoine Riard
|
8eb20e36aa
|
correction aggregation + gestion erreur de syntax - heredoc en meme temps
|
2017-03-09 18:39:53 +01:00 |
|
Antoine Riard
|
791b99e469
|
last commit
|
2017-03-08 23:18:55 +01:00 |
|
Jack Halford
|
764c62cc45
|
changed header layout
|
2017-03-07 18:37:13 +01:00 |
|
Antoine Riard
|
74b9f83779
|
renforcement stack + correction erreur syntax
|
2017-03-07 15:52:54 +01:00 |
|
Antoine Riard
|
8873f31f79
|
protection stack symbolique
|
2017-03-06 17:57:51 +01:00 |
|
Antoine Riard
|
e675eceb87
|
redirection ok, further test needed
|
2017-03-06 15:58:30 +01:00 |
|
AntoHesse
|
2b5b23e981
|
execution case without extension
|
2017-03-06 02:11:03 +01:00 |
|
AntoHesse
|
4849c899e4
|
execution for without expansion
|
2017-03-06 01:10:54 +01:00 |
|
Antoine Riard
|
2b456eac9c
|
rectification cleanage code
|
2017-03-05 16:40:22 +01:00 |
|
Antoine Riard
|
56b106ee0f
|
gen ast cleand
|
2017-03-04 22:08:31 +01:00 |
|
Antoine Riard
|
7d660fec7c
|
execution if/elif/else + while ok
|
2017-03-04 18:02:38 +01:00 |
|
AntoHesse
|
dc423db858
|
stack is now a beautiful linked list
|
2017-03-04 02:17:06 +01:00 |
|
Antoine Riard
|
29692ef8fa
|
ast free
|
2017-03-03 20:02:53 +01:00 |
|
Antoine Riard
|
d0b821c483
|
pipe fix grammar + assignement word parsing
|
2017-03-03 17:19:39 +01:00 |
|
Antoine Riard
|
37d9898f59
|
doing pipe + lst cmds
|
2017-03-02 22:02:53 +01:00 |
|
ariard@student.42.fr
|
aa9097575d
|
rewef
|
2017-03-01 18:04:29 +01:00 |
|
ariard@student.42.fr
|
7b1d505a5b
|
gen func ok, todo: multi branch declaration, probleme lexer sur brackets
|
2017-02-25 00:31:51 +01:00 |
|
ariard@student.42.fr
|
102196bff4
|
parsing brace_clause + func def ok
|
2017-02-24 23:17:29 +01:00 |
|
ariard@student.42.fr
|
0461285d95
|
subshell et case ok
|
2017-02-24 19:30:20 +01:00 |
|
AntoHesse
|
79bceb05a9
|
trop fatigue pour debug les case nesting, fuck it, todo tomorrow
|
2017-02-23 01:55:09 +01:00 |
|
AntoHesse
|
268c5fb46e
|
syntax error + coordination parser etat
|
2017-02-22 18:36:32 +01:00 |
|
AntoHesse
|
5976d0d281
|
grammar case part 1 motherfucker
|
2017-02-22 01:43:25 +01:00 |
|
ariard@student.42.fr
|
49b79603b3
|
insert newline add
|
2017-02-21 22:45:59 +01:00 |
|
ariard@student.42.fr
|
04c4978c35
|
Merge branch 'pda' of https://github.com/jzck/42sh into pda
"conflict resolved"
|
2017-02-21 20:33:12 +01:00 |
|
ariard@student.42.fr
|
fffb8c74a5
|
before pull main clean
|
2017-02-21 20:29:46 +01:00 |
|
Jack Halford
|
ec79b05131
|
new instruction handler looks good
|
2017-02-21 20:21:52 +01:00 |
|
ariard@student.42.fr
|
d05cec4962
|
include + parser state
|
2017-02-21 16:46:13 +01:00 |
|
Jack Halford
|
c04006a471
|
fixed some merging problems : it compiles now
|
2017-02-20 22:41:02 +01:00 |
|